Designed to provide energised every day running through the citys streets, the On Womens Cloudswift 4 in BlackWhite features improved fit and hold through the midfoot, with a modern, urban aesthetic. This running-specific version uses a flatknit engineered mesh with a bootie fit and a cage construction around the midfoot, giving improved support and lockdown for the support you need when navigating the city's streets. Underfoot, you get a layer of Helion foam then a forked, nylon blend Speedboard. Beneath that you get more Helion, and the famous CloudTec pods, all giving you a cushioned, responsive feel with plenty of go forward. Stack height 31mm 23mm, heel offset 8mm. Sock-like upper with 3D heel padding for comfort and support. Adaptive fit for a wide range of foot shapes. Sat above a grippy rubber outsole, they're signed off with signature On Running branding throughout.
